Top 10 MariaDB GUI tools to explore in 2024

Shreelekha Singh
/
Feb 26, 2025
/
12
min read

Building databases with MariaDB means navigating complex syntax and deprecated features during version upgrades. MariaDB also poses security challenges. Any error in configuring user permissions can create a threat of unauthorized access.

Moreover, it’s difficult to implement a scalable architecture with MariaDB, especially when handling large volumes of data.

A good Graphical User Interface (GUI) software can make life easy when working with MariaDB.

MariaDB GUI tools can simplify data management and optimize performance. The result? Higher efficiency and a scalable architecture.

First, we’ll break down the key factors to consider when evaluating MariaDB GUI tools. Then, check out our 10 best recommendations.

5 key factors to look for in MariaDB GUI tools

Here’s a handy checklist of features to consider for choosing the ideal GUI tool for your needs:

  • Ease of use: GUI tools help manage databases more intuitively. Pick tools that support drag-and-drop functionality with forms for data entry. These capabilities will make the database management process more efficient and reduce errors.
  • Data management: A good GUI tool offers quick customization options like adding, deleting, and editing rows. These tools also offer functions to search, filter, and sort your database. You can conveniently manage your database in a few clicks instead of writing SQL queries for every action. 
  • Multiple data source management: Does your company have data outside of MariaDB, or will it ever in the future? Ensure your GUI tool allows data from multiple sources with seamless integration.
  • Visual query building: Look for tools with a built-in query builder to create and edit your SQL queries without writing code manually. This capability will save time when building complex queries for creating tables and other elements.  
  • Design and modeling: You need a tool to visualize your database with a graphical schema easily. Look for design features that allow you to intuitively create relationships, tables, and indexes without writing SQL scripts. 
  • Permission management: A good GUI software tool for MariaDB also simplifies the process of managing multiple user accounts. Grant or restrict access for different users with checkboxes and use forms to collect more data. 

Lastly, look for tools that support cross-platform functionality. This makes it easier to collaborate with your team members with a consistent user experience on Windows, macOS, and Linux devices. 

Top 10 MariaDB GUI tools to simplify database management

Now, let’s look at our 10 best picks for MariaDB GUI tools with the key features and workflows explained for each tool. 

Softr

Pricing: Free plan, paid plans start at $49/month 

Compatible with: Windows, macOS, Linux

Softr is a no-code GUI platform that connects your MariaDB database in seconds without manual imports. 

With Softr, you can build internal tools or apps by integrating your databases and designing the user interface effortlessly. You can go from zero to one and launch a data-driven app in just three steps:

  • Choose MariaDB as your data source from all the different options available. 
  • Use custom queries to visualize your data and customize your interface design.
  • Test and make iterations before sharing it with your entire team or clients. 

Put simply, Softr makes it easy to share data with different stakeholders—both internal and external. Moreover, you can maintain data privacy and maximize security with permission management settings. 

What makes Softr a good GUI tool

Softr is a versatile GUI platform to build powerful apps. Whether you’re using a simple spreadsheet or a complex database like MariaDB, Softr makes it easy to design and develop data-driven platforms. 

Here are a few factors that make Softr the best GUI tool for MariaDB databases:

  • Make it easy for anyone to build data-driven apps without coding skills.
  • No limits to the number of records added for building scalable databases. 
  • Short learning curve and an intuitive drag-and-drop editor to design the layout.

MySQL Workbench

Pricing: Community Edition available for free, Enterprise edition licensed through Oracle

Compatible with: Windows, macOS, Linux

MySQL Workbench is a unified visual tool for developers and database architects working with MariaDB. It offers a suite of tools for SQL development, data modeling, and server configuration. 

You can visually design and manage your databases. The platform also lets you build complex ER models and implement change management operations.

What makes MySQL Workbench a good GUI tool

Database architects can execute SQL queries with multi-node analytics, single-node transactions, and replicated transitions. Moreover, MySQL Workbench provides a comprehensive performance dashboard to identify high-cost SQL statements and IO hotspots. It’s great for optimizing queries quickly. 

phpMyAdmin

Pricing: Free

Compatible with: Windows, macOS, and Linux

phpMyAdmin is an open-source software that is purpose-built to manage the MySQL database. The browser-based platform simplifies database management, including browsing and dropping databases and creating tables, columns, indexes, and relations.

You can also manage users, privileges, and access permissions easily. phpMyAdmin lets you execute any SQL statement and run batch queries as well. 

What makes phpMyAdmin a good GUI tool

One of phpMyAdmin’s unique value propositions is that it’s available in 72 languages and supports LTR and RTL languages. The software allows you to export data in multiple formats, such as SQL, CSV, XML, PDF, and more. 

With the query-by-example (QBE) approach, you can create complex queries. The tool also allows you to work conveniently on the maintenance server and configurations. 

HeidiSQL

Pricing: Free

Compatible with: Windows, macOS, and Linux

HeidiSQL is another one of the free MariaDB GUI tools on our list. You can use this tool to edit and customize data structures running on MariaDB. 

The tool lets you connect to several servers in one window with the option to connect via command line, SSH tunnel, or pass SSL settings. You can also execute MariaDB queries with distributed transitions, replicated transitions, multi-node analytics, and more. 

What makes HeidiSQL a good GUI tool

HeidiSQL lets you export one server or database directly into another database. You can export table rows in different formats, including HTML, CSV, XML, SQL, and more. The tool offers the option to bulk edit tables and customize your databases—regardless of their size—quickly. 

DBeaver

Pricing: Paid plans start at $11/month

Compatible with: Windows, macOS, and Linux

DBeaver is compatible with multiple database tools, including MariaDB. Developers can use this platform to work with databases like MySQL, PostgreSQL, and Oracle. 

DBeaver’s advanced SQL editor lets you highlight syntax, execute multiple queries, and work more efficiently with auto-completion. It also minimizes errors when creating and running queries seamlessly.

What makes DBeaver a good GUI tool

DBeaver supports complex authorization processes, like single sign-up, multi-factor authentication, and Kerberos. This high level of security makes it a good choice for keeping your data secure. 

The platform also offers various data visualization capabilities to capture patterns and present relationships. 

DbSchema

Pricing: Free

Compatible with: Windows, macOS, and Linux

DbSchema reverse engineers your database structure to visualize data well without writing SQL queries. The platform lets you create tables, add columns, design indexes, and manage data relationships.

Its interactive layout can handle large databases with over 10,000 tables. The tool simplifies database design and helps developers organize their work with diagrams, query results, SQL editors, and similar tools. 

What makes DbSchema a good GUI tool

DbSchema works well with multiple MariaDB databases. It also makes it easy to track and apply changes incrementally. The platform also lets you generate migration scripts to ensure two or more versions have the same schema. 

Moreover, you can design schemas for any database offline. DbSchema’s data explorer also saves time with quick functions to update records. 

Forest Admin

Pricing: Free trial, paid plans start at $48/month

Compatible with: Windows, macOS, and Linux

Forest Admin is another one of MariaDB's GUI tools worth exploring. Purpose-built for designing internal apps, the platform offers a fully-featured admin panel to operationalize your data. 

Integrate your MariaDB database and customize the admin panel to best fit your needs. You can also connect other databases like PostgreSQL, Microsoft SQL Server, MongoDB, etc. Its architecture ensures that nobody except your designated users has access to your user data. 

What makes Forest Admin a good GUI tool

Forest Admin offers an intuitive platform to edit, search, and filter your databases. You can also build automated workflows using trigger-based logic rules. 

The tool offers various visualization options to monitor your data accurately and simplify interpretation.

Beekeeper Studio

Pricing: Paid plans start at $7/month

Compatible with: Windows, macOS, and Linux

Beekeeper Studio is a cross-platform GUI software to neatly visualize your MariaDB databases. The platform offers a user-friendly tabbed interface to design your databases by opening multiple queries and tables in different tabs. 

Besides, you can pin the frequently used tables for quick access. Developers can also save SQL queries in the built-in storage function and access them anytime in the future. 

What makes Beekeper Studio a good GUI tool

Beekeeper Studio supports several database platforms and makes it easy to work with different types of servers. It’s also easy to track your SQL queries and access any queries you recently executed. 

The easy creation and customization capabilities also make Beekeeper a good GUI tool for visualizing your database. 

DataGrip

Pricing: Free

Compatible with: Windows, macOS, and Linux

DataGrip is another cross-platform tool for different databases, including MariaDB. The platform offers an intelligent query console to track all the changes and ensure you don’t lose any progress.

Developers can also write code faster by completing context-sensitive code. DataGrip will automatically analyze your table structure and database objects to edit or complete your code. 

What makes DataGrip a good GUI tool

DataGrip’s multi-engine database environment is powerful enough to generate SQL queries based on a simple conversation. You just need to explain your data in simple language, and the AI assistant will create SQL commands in seconds. 

Moreover, the platform can analyze two or more versions simultaneously to highlight key differences and track changes easily. 

You’re all set to choose the perfect MariaDB GUI tool

MariaDB databases can be difficult to handle due to complicated configurations and several restrictions. 

However, a good GUI tool can streamline data management and improve performance when writing and running SQL queries. Plus, you can also build a scalable and secure architecture for your database with reliable GUI software. 

Take your time to explore and evaluate our 10 best recommendations. If you want to get started quickly with a user-friendly GUI software, Softr is the right choice. Sign up for free to see how Softr works with MariaDB (and other data sources).

What is Softr
Softr is the easiest way to turn your data into powerful business apps—no code required. Connect to your spreadsheet or database, customize layout and logic, and share with your team or clients.

Join 700,000+ users worldwide, building client portals, internal tools, CRMs, dashboards, project management systems, inventory management apps, and more—all without code.
Get started free
Shreelekha Singh

Categories
No items found.

Build an app today. It’s free!

Build and launch your first portal or internal tool in under 30 minutes
Get started free